Nolan County Climate and Weather Averages

Hottest month — July

95.0°

average daily high. The coldest month is January, averaging a low of 29.3°F.

Nolan County gets 23.91" of precipitation a year, and 35% of it falls in Apr, May, Jun.

MonthAvg highAvg low Precip
January 58.6° 29.3° 1.10"
February 62.8° 33.6° 1.16"
March 70.7° 42.0° 1.61"
April 78.6° 50.6° 2.01"
May 85.5° 59.0° 3.63"
June 91.9° 66.5° 2.64"
July 95.0° 68.4° 1.30"
August 93.9° 68.6° 2.71"
September 87.6° 61.6° 2.72"
October 78.2° 50.2° 2.47"
November 67.3° 38.0° 1.50"
December 59.4° 31.4° 1.06"

What this climate costs you

Degree days measure how hard a building has to work to stay comfortable. They are the reason two identical houses have very different power bills, and they are the link between the weather here and what you pay every month.

Cooling degree days How much air conditioning the climate demands 2,198
Heating degree days How much heating the climate demands 2,644
Approximate annual cooling cost At 16.44¢/kWh, Texas average $361
Approximate annual electric heating cost Lower where heating is gas rather than electric $152

These are rough planning figures from degree days and the state electricity price, not a bill estimate. House size, insulation and fuel type move them a lot. See the full cost of owning a home in Nolan County, where electricity is one line of eight.

Common questions

What is the weather like in Nolan County?

Nolan County averages a high of 95.0°F in July and a low of 29.3°F in January. Annual precipitation is 23.91 inches, with essentially no snow.

When is the rainy season in Nolan County?

The wettest stretch is Apr, May, Jun, which accounts for 35% of the year's precipitation. Precipitation is relatively evenly distributed across the year.

How hot does it get in Nolan County?

The average daily high in July, the hottest month, is 95.0°F. That drives 2,198 cooling degree days a year, which is what your air conditioning has to work against.

Does it snow in Nolan County?

Effectively no. Measurable snowfall is rare in Nolan County.
